Output 13ec8b309349498cd53212096e5d77e1d1e5f098d3aa9bb47ad201fdd5f8d7ea:22

value
21538
script pubkey
OP_0 OP_PUSHBYTES_20 6d2d7cb42c2fd01502f5d914f6869b15274de437
address
bc1qd5khedpv9lgp2qh4my20dp5mz5n5mephzy5u3e
transaction
13ec8b309349498cd53212096e5d77e1d1e5f098d3aa9bb47ad201fdd5f8d7ea